Ryanair staff were forced to strap an "unruly" passenger to his seat using spare belts after he refused to sit down during landing, onlookers said.
The passenger on the flight from Manchester to Rhodes was shouting at cabin crew who confiscated two bottles of booze from him and refused to serve him alcohol, onlookers said.
He refused to sit down during landing - escaping from restraints - forcing the pilot to abort the descent, circle round, and land again.
Rhodes police were called on to the flight upon landing to take the man off the plane, on April 3.
